UK Polling History: Election of 9 April 1992 – Slough
Result summary
Parties | ||||
Conservative | Labour | Liberal Democrat |
Other | |
Votes | 25,793 | 25,279 | 4,041 | 2,702 |
Votes gained | -373 | +3,203 | – | +1,849 |
Share of votes | 44.6% | 43.7% | 7.0% | 4.7% |
Share of eligible voters | 34.9% | 34.2% | 5.5% | 3.7% |
Gain in share of votes | -2.3% | +4.1% | – | +3.0% |
Gain in share of eligible voters | -0.7% | +4.1% | – | +2.5% |
Total votes: | 57,815 | |
Electorate: | 73,889 | |
Turnout: | 78.2% | |
Outcome: | Conservative hold | |
Swing: | 3.2% | Labour from Conservative |
